E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
联合主键
jvm类加载器
第二范式(确保表中的每列都和主键相关)第二范式需要确保数据库表中每一列都和主键相关,而不能只与主键的某一部分相关(主要针对
联合主键
而言)。
可爱的小小小狼
·
2024-02-14 06:19
java
jvm
大数据常见面试题
index:加速查找1.2、唯一索引主键索引:primarykey:加速查找+约束(不为空且唯一)唯一索引:unique:加速查找+约束(唯一)1.3、联合索引primarykey(id,name):
联合主键
索引
ChlinRei
·
2024-02-08 14:25
面试
大数据
hadoop
java
编码技巧——批量删除数据
1.背景今天遇到个业务场景需要批量根据索引删除数据,ORM框架为mybatis,跟以往遇到的根据MySQL主键批量删除不同,本次使用的数据库时PgSQL,使用的
联合主键
索引;搜索相关资料网上大部分帖子都是使用类似
七海健人
·
2024-02-08 09:15
代码技巧
sql
批量删除
mybatis
springboot jpa 复合主键
联合主键
为什么80%的码农都做不了架构师?>>>在开发中,数据库中定义了一个复合主键,这时候在映射不稍微处理下会有一点问题。什么doesnotdefineanIdClass错误,乱七八糟的。反正就是有问题。进入正题。1、首先定义一个复合主键类。也就是复合主键的名称,一定和数据库匹配。我数据库的主键就是aa_id和bb_id,因为使用mysql,jpa的默认命名方式,就是驼峰映射数据库变成下划线,就不多介绍
weixin_34167819
·
2024-02-04 19:39
java
数据库
JPA实体类中使用
联合主键
参考链接:JPAPrimaryKey业务场景:实体类Aaabc中需要将id1、id2作为
联合主键
来使用方式一:使用@IdClass首先定义IdClass类importlombok.Data;importjava.io.Serializable
wsdhla
·
2024-02-04 19:39
#
Spring
jpa
IdClass
Embeddable
EmbeddedId
主键
联合主键
Spring JPA Group By,
联合主键
(多主键)
项目是Springboot,想要使用SpringJPA实现GroupBy功能,但是Spring支持的查询关键字不包括GroupBy,只能另辟蹊径了。SpringDataJPA-ReferenceDocumentationhttps://docs.spring.io/spring-data/jpa/docs/current/reference/html/#repository-query-keywo
秋天的妖风
·
2024-02-04 19:09
spring
java
数据库
Spring Data JPA配置使用
联合主键
demo
我们在SpringBoot下使用SpringDataJPA,在项目的Maven依赖里添加spring-boot-stater-data-jpa,然后只需定义DataSource、实体类和数据访问层,并在需要使用数据访问的地方注入数据访问层的Bean即可,无须任何额外配置。pom.xml引入依赖:org.springframework.bootspring-boot-starter-data-jpa
星前冷
·
2024-02-04 19:09
mysql学习
Java
SpringBoot JPA配置
联合主键
文章目录介绍解决打完收工!介绍工作中使用的是JPA作为持久化管理,跟之前使用的mybatis不太一样,因为他有自己的HQL语言,能根据方法签名自动推断sql。只要在entity实例中配置好@Id,这个就是主键,很多方法都会根据这个来进行推断,比如save方法,这个方法实际有两个工作:insert和update,具体区分方法就是先去数据库根据配置好的主键查询数据,如果没有就进行insert,有的话就
梦幻D开始
·
2024-02-04 19:07
工作记录
spring
boot
技术杂记
spring
boot
jpa
联合主键
添加约束(八)
1.2
联合主键
使用多个列作为主键列,当多个列的值都相同时,则违
二狗的编程之路
·
2024-02-02 00:52
mysql
数据库
mysql
28 python快速上手
索引和函数及存储过程1.索引1.1索引原理1.1.1非聚簇索引(mysiam引擎)1.1.2聚簇索引(innodb引擎)1.2常见索引1.2.1主键和
联合主键
索引1.2.2唯一和联合唯一索引1.2.3索引和联合索引案例
笛秋白
·
2024-01-31 21:49
pyhon全栈开发
MYSQL
python
android
开发语言
MySQL索引
联合索引包括
联合主键
索引、联合唯一索引、联合普通索引。全文索引根据词条来确定位置。空间索引对空间数据类型
黄名富
·
2024-01-30 04:11
数据库
数据库
sql
数据结构
力扣白嫖日记(sql)
今日题目:1179.重新格式化部门表表:Department列名类型idintrevenueintmonthvarchar在SQL中,(id,month)是表的
联合主键
。
Gary.Li
·
2024-01-28 04:43
leetcode
sql
数据库
数据库设计的一些原则
文章目录数据库设计原则表之间的关系一对一关系(了解)一对多(多对一)多对多
联合主键
和复合主键数据库设计准则-范式1、函数依赖2、完全函数依赖3、部分函数依赖4、传递函数依赖5、码第一范式第二范式第三范式第三范式数据库设计原则表之间的关系一对一人和身份证一个人只有一个身份证
小哼快跑
·
2024-01-27 10:45
MySQL
数据库
三范式
表和表关系
MySQL之约束
文章目录约束主键约束添加单列主键添加多列主键(
联合主键
)修改表结构以添加主键删除主键约束自增长约束非空约束唯一约束默认约束零填充约束约束我们在之前创建表的时候有提到过约束条件(constraint),他的作用就是用于约束表中的数据
一只小松许捏
·
2024-01-25 23:04
MySQL
mysql
数据库
sql
MySQL 无法修改主键?原来是因为这个参数
同事咨询了一个问题,TDSQL(forMySQL)中的某张表主键需要改为
联合主键
,是否必须先删除现有的主键?因为删除主键时,提示这个错误。
爱可生开源社区
·
2024-01-23 17:43
mysql
MYSQL 4.数据库设计
多表关系一对一如人和身份证的关系一对多如部门和员工的关系多对多如学生和课程一个学生可以选择多门课程一门课程可以被多个学生选择一对多设计思想:在多的一面建立外键指向一的一方的主键多对多设计思想:多对多的关系实现需要借助第三张中间表中间表至少包含两个字段这两个字段作为第三张表的外键分别指向两张表的主键(
联合主键
第二套广播体操
·
2024-01-20 11:46
关于约束的增删改查、关于数据表的管理和关于DML数据操作(增删改查)
dropprimarykey;3.默认情况下AUTO_INCREMENT的开始值是1,如果希望修改开始值不为1,可以使用如下SQL:ALTERTABLE表名AUTO_INCREMENT=开始值;4.在建表时加
联合主键
程序筱王
·
2024-01-18 13:19
MySQL约束的分类
数据操作的分类
sql
数据库
hibernate多主键怎么自动生成表结构
首先,创建一个表示
联合主键
的类,使用@Embeddable注解标注该类。在该类中定义多个主键属性,并重写equals()和hashCode()方法。
正在努力学习的小菜鸟
·
2024-01-18 11:53
hibernate
java
后端
[蓝桥杯 2016 省 AB] 四平方和
并对所有的可能表示法按a,b,c,d为
联合主键
升序排列,最后输出第一个表示法。输入格式程序
EternalLBZ
·
2024-01-14 18:51
蓝桥杯
数据库三大范式(图文详解)
(主属性即主键;完全依赖是针对于
联合主键
的情况,非主键列不能只依赖于主键的一部分)第三范式(3NF):满足第二范式;且不存在传递依赖,
Keson Z
·
2024-01-11 01:14
#
MySQL
数据库
java
开发语言
MySQL面试题汇总
即,表中任意一个主键或任意一组
联合主键
,可以确定除该主键外的所有的非主键值。(一个表只能描述一件事情)3NF:在满足第二范式的情况下,消除传递依赖。
我真的很帅阿
·
2024-01-08 04:16
Java八股
mysql
数据库
面试
SQL的
联合主键
在SQL中,
联合主键
是指由多个列组成的主键。
联合主键
的作用是确保每一行数据的唯一性,即组合列的值必须唯一。
独木人生
·
2024-01-05 11:33
SQL
sql
数据库
mysql中主键和外键自带索引_MySQL:主键、外键、索引(一)
可以使用多个列作为
联合主键
,但
联合主键
并不常用。关系数据库通过外键可以实现一对多、多对多和一对一的关系。外键既可以通过数据库来约束,也可以不设置约束,仅依靠应用程序的逻辑来保证。
霜之暗伤
·
2024-01-04 14:04
mysql中主键和外键自带索引
MySQL最强八股文,用最通俗的话,讲最明白的道理(基础到架构)
A:第一范式:又称专一范式,字段不能再拆分;第二范式:又称MySQL家规,必须完全依赖顺从主键,若有与主键无关字段者,设置为
联合主键
;第三范式:又称恋爱脑范式,遵守家规,远离小三。
CS_GUIDER
·
2024-01-04 05:45
mysql
架构
数据库
mysql面试题(最全)
(主属性即主键;完全依赖是针对于
联合主键
的情况,非主键列不能只依赖于主键的一部分)第三范式(3NF):满足第
其然乐衣
·
2023-12-28 07:52
数据库
mysql
数据库
面试
mysql(32) : mybatis分区管理(按小时分区)
.51cto.com/lawsonabs/3061281mysql按小时分区_mysql怎么按小时分区_没有幻觉的博客-CSDN博客无分区初始化分区及创建小时分区,定时删除旧分区注意:分区字段必须为主键字段,
联合主键
Lxinccode
·
2023-12-24 10:05
mysql
mysql分区管理
mysql(29) : mybatis分区管理(按天分区)
无分区初始化分区及创建明日分区,定时删除旧分区注意:分区字段必须为主键字段,
联合主键
,字段类型为datetimejobimportcom.alibaba.bkbox.pull.image.repository.mapper.PartitionManagerMapper
Lxinccode
·
2023-12-24 10:35
mysql
mysql
数据库
database
分区管理
数据库的三大范式
每个属性都是不可分割的原子项(实体的属性就是表中的列)在上表中contact应该分为phone和adress两列第二范式:在满足第一范式的情况下,表中不存在部分依赖,非主键列要完全依赖于主键(主要是在
联合主键
的情况下
春日部小学森
·
2023-12-16 22:05
MySQL
数据库
mysql
PostgreSQL11 | pgsql建表、改表与删表
/IFZpx已经讲解了最简单的pgadmin的数据库创建、外键等可视化的操作,以及对应的pgsql语句这一篇文章将讲解基础的pgsql语句建表、改表与删表目录建表、改表与删表创建数据表单字段主键多字段
联合主键
外键约束非空约束
红星编程实验室
·
2023-12-16 12:56
Postgresql
数据库
sql
postgresql
TDsql中
联合主键
怎么创建,Hibernate注解映射
联合主键
列名1数据类型,列名2数据类型,...PRIMARYKEY(列名1,列名2));如果想给主键起个名字,可以这么写:CREATETABLE表名(列名1数据类型,列名2数据类型,...CONSTRAINT
联合主键
名称
见未见过的风景
·
2023-12-15 16:49
#
sql
sql
数据库
java
Hibernate
联合主键
写法
Entity实体类:@Entity//实体类注解@Data@Table(name="AA")//表注解@IdClass(value=AaId.class)//
联合主键
注解publicclassAaimplementsSerializable
米米_a13d
·
2023-12-05 20:58
mysql 进阶到高级_Mysql 高级进阶
Mysql-高级进阶Mysql-索引索引类型作用普通索引加速查找主键索引加速查找+唯一+不能为空唯一索引加速查找+唯一联合索引
联合主键
+联合唯一+联合普通概览说明:直接创佳索引会创建额外的临时文件,以某种文件存储
考满分GMAT
·
2023-11-25 14:49
mysql
进阶到高级
【Q3——30min】
(主属性即主键;完全依赖是针对于
联合主键
的情况,非主键列不能只依赖于主键的一部分)第三范式(3NF):满足第二范式;且不存在传递依赖,即非主属性不能与非主属性之间有依赖关系,非主属性必须直接依赖于主
eeeee-
·
2023-11-24 13:52
数据库
c++
开发语言
MySQL数据库基础知识回顾
)数值类型(2)日期/时间类型(3)字符串类型a.文本数据类型b.二进制类型数据关系的基本概念关系的基本特点数据库范式第一范式(1NF):每一列保持原子特性第二范式(2NF):属性完全依赖于主键(针对
联合主键
心皿月
·
2023-11-23 11:22
MySQL数据库
数据库
mysql
java
MySQL数据表查询group by的用法及distinct区别
由多条变成比较少记录的过程是分组聚合,既然需要分组,就要考虑使用哪个字段进行分组最好,一般来说,主键才是groupby后面的分组字段主键(PRIMARYKEY)的完整称呼是“主键约束”,分为单字段主键和多字段
联合主键
_Johnny_
·
2023-11-22 16:52
MySQL
mysql
数据库
database
联合主键
做外键
一.创建PK类importjava.io.Serializable;publicclassPKCodeimplementsSerializable{privateIntegercode;privateIntegercodeType;publicIntegergetCode(){returncode;}publicvoidsetCode(Integercode){this.code=code;}pu
xiaojianhx
·
2023-11-20 00:57
HIBERNATE
java
Mysql使用
联合主键
时,并不是每个主键字段都能使用索引
问题:Mysql使用
联合主键
时,每个主键字段都能使用索引吗?
bubu风
·
2023-11-19 23:13
mysql操作 sql语句中的完整性约束有哪些,主键约束、外键约束、引用完整性约束,主键外键、唯一性
文章目录前言:建表正文一、实体完整性约束1.主键约束2.唯一性约束3.自增长约束4.
联合主键
约束二、域完整性约束三、引用完整性约束1.外键约束讲约束一般是在创建表时,对字段名进行约束,所以这里先讲如何创建表
小学鸡!
·
2023-11-16 22:10
MySQL
mysql
sql
数据库
MySQL数据库基本操作-约束
目录标题1、分类2、主键3、
联合主键
4、修改表结构添加主键5、删除主键约束6、自增约束7、指定自增字段约束8、非空约束9、唯一约束10、默认约束11、外键约束12、删除外键约束1、分类--每个表最多只允许一个主键
程序员小王꧔ꦿ
·
2023-11-13 16:03
MySQL
数据库
mysql
sql
【flink-sql实战】flink 主键声明与upsert功能实战
文章目录一.flink主键声明语法二.物理表创建
联合主键
表三.flinksql使用一.flink主键声明语法主键用作Flink优化的一种提示信息。
roman_日积跬步-终至千里
·
2023-11-11 21:41
#
flink
实战
sql
flink
数据库
面试--mysql基础
(主属性即主键;完全依赖是针对于
联合主键
的情况,非主键列不能只依赖于主键的一部分)第三范式(3NF):满足第二范式;且不存在传递依赖,即非主属性不能与非主属性之间有依赖关系,非主属性必须直接依赖于主属性
yelrihsss
·
2023-11-09 19:56
面试
面试
mysql
navicat设置mysql索引
2.Unique唯一索引:主键索引:primarykey:加速查找+约束(不为空且唯一)唯一索引:unique:加速查找+约束(唯一)3.联合索引:-primarykey(id,name):
联合主键
索引
猴子年华、
·
2023-11-07 18:21
navicat
navicat
mysql
5.数据表基本操作
2.多字段
联合主键
外键:非空约束:唯一性约束:(1)在定义完列之后直接指定唯一约束,语法规则如下:(2)在定义完所有列之后指定唯一约束,语法规则如下:默认约束:表的属性值自动增加:2.查看表结构DESCRIBE
[禾火]
·
2023-11-06 09:53
数据库
数据库
玩转Mybatis的高级关系映射(实战加详解,保姆级教程)
多对多:产生中间关系表,引入两张表的主键作为外键,两个主键成为
联合主键
或使用新的字段作为主键。ResultMap(结果映射)简单理解如下:Mybatis中javaType和jdbcType对应关系
中午吃点啥
·
2023-11-06 07:37
mybatis
resultMap
association
MySQL 约束
主键分为两种类型:单字段主键和多字段
联合主键
。a.单字段主键主键由一
HuaLuLemon
·
2023-11-05 06:26
MySQL
mysql
数据库
sql
JPA
联合主键
查询重复解决方案
数据库数据:
联合主键
表,接口查询始终出现相同的第一行值(接口是groupid倒序):具体解决方案请查看红色字体部分:importcom.fasterxml.jackson.annotation.JsonInclude
窦再兴
·
2023-11-03 01:25
技术贴
jpa
联合主键
Jpa
联合主键
第一步,先写一个作为
联合主键
的实体类,把
联合主键
两列放进来importlombok.AllArgsConstructor;importlombok.Data;importlombok.EqualsAndHashCode
乘风破浪~~
·
2023-11-03 01:54
数据库
sql
java
JPA
联合主键
在实际工作中,我们会经常遇到
联合主键
的情况,所以我用简单例子列举JPA两种实现
联合主键
的方式。
浮华1994
·
2023-11-03 01:14
Spring
Data
Jpa
jpa
java
chapter10_关系数据库设计理论_1_关系模型的存储异常
,借书人所在单位,单位负责人,借阅图书编号,借阅日期)(1)数据冗余每借一本书,都要重复存储所在单位,单位负责人的信息(2)插入异常如果一个人没有借书,那么他就无法加入数据库中,因为当前数据库采用的是
联合主键
米都都
·
2023-11-02 02:20
MySQL数据库干货_08—— MySQL中的主键约束(Primary Key)
联合主键
使用多个列作为主键列,当多个列的值都相同时,则违反唯一约束。
OldGj_
·
2023-10-30 06:53
MySQL数据库_干货满满
数据库
mysql
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他